Apple Vision Pro will launch in the US next month –

Published on

Apple is looking to finally get the Vision Pro headset into the hands of consumers, or at least consumers in the US. Tech giant Announce The Space PC headset will debut in the United States on February 2, 2024, and that pre-orders for the device will be available starting January 19, 2024.
“The age of spatial computing has arrived,” said Apple CEO Tim Cook. “Apple Vision Pro is the most advanced consumer electronics device ever. Its revolutionary Magic UI will redefine how we connect, create and explore.”

Vision Pro is a system that hopes to change the way we use computers to work and communicate. It uses the VisionOS operating system to blend digital content with the real world, while users can control and interact with the device using their eyes, hands and voice. It remains to be seen whether the device will be able to achieve such a massive feat.

What we do know is that the Vision Pro will retail starting at a whopping $3,499, with the price increasing depending on versions with larger built-in storage, and that consumers will also be able to spend money on additional extras like optical inserts for those who wear glasses ranging from Between $99 and $149.

As for when the rest of the world can get the Vision Pro, Apple hasn't announced a wider release date yet.
